Es tut sich was innerhalb von Works. Letztens habe ich bei einem kleinen Developer-Frühstücks-Talk das Thema “Utils” angerissen. Es scheint ja wohl so zu sein, dass wirklich jeder seinen eigenen kleinen Utils-Namespace hat.
Bei mir ist das ja auch nicht anders. Wenn man mal ein paar Projekte hinter sich hat, kommen ja auch ein paar Kleinigkeiten zusammen. Naheliegend also die Idee, die zusammengehäuften Code-Fragmente mal in Works einzustellen.
Gesagt getan. Ab heute gibt es das “Inconspicuous Code Files”-Projekt in Works. Ja, es gibt einfachere Bezeichnungen für Util-Klassen, also gleich hinterher die Abkürzung: ICF. Ist ja auch ein wenig flüssiger in der Aussprache.
Zum Start der ICF habe ich mir einen – meiner Meinung nach – “Klassiker” ausgesucht: EventArgs<T>. Vor allem bei kleineren und mittelgroßen Projekten ist es eine hilfreiche Klasse, die einem unnötiges Getippe erspart. Und für die Konventionsfanatiker, die trotzdem eindeutige, klare EventArgs haben wollen, ist es immerhin eine gute Basis-Klasse.
Mit der Zeit werde ich sicher auch den Rest peu à peu einstellen – aber es gibt ja auch so noch einiges zu tun.
Comments